Output 63fc22c62bea9d959053ae8e78c5733891934b05abc1ae112807df586dceed17:75

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ea9ddcc5375e3d5ea7f511ff629282df2cbb02ca2915c54721bf9f0ab3ce4c5
address
bc1pt65amnznwh3at6nl2y0lv2fg9hevhvpv52g4c4rjr0ulp2euunzs9q8ldf
transaction
63fc22c62bea9d959053ae8e78c5733891934b05abc1ae112807df586dceed17
spent
true